The Engine Center (EC) Assembly Materials Organization has a rare opportunity for a Materials Requirement Planning (MRP) Internship in Middletown, CT.Key Job Responsibilities Include:
Work on projects in support of assembly floor need, working closely with the on-campus Forward Stocking Location (FSL)and remote warehouses
Utilize Lean principles to establish world-class Materials Flow/Synchronization within the value stream
Expand on current shortage management process
Support efforts to drive cost & lead time reductions.
